New Sales Only and Service Only Apps
One of the common customization requests we see is removing either the service features or sales features for particular groups of users. This usually led to creating hybrid apps for a customer. This came up often enough that we decided to add these two hybrid apps to the core solution.
So now you have more options. Some users can use the full RapidStartCRM app, but maybe your Sales team only needs to work with the sales capabilities, and they can use the new RapidStartCRM Sales app. Similar to your service team. See the Sales Only app below:
As you can see, all references to Cases are removed for the Sales Only app, providing an even more simple app for your Sales Only users. Similarly, all references to Opportunities and Prospects are removed for the Service Only app. This enhancement clearly met our simple-to-use mantra.
More Quick Steps buttons
One of the most loved features of RapidStartCRM is our unique Quick Steps buttons. Designed to save you steps on the Summary page of records. In the new RapidStartCRM, we have added Quick Steps buttons to relevant tabs also.
The goal is to save you even more steps, by adding Quick Step buttons to where you are at the moment. These have been added to several places throughout RapidStartCRM.
